Transaction 81fbb4e8af1b25dea1cc5d3dc3961df04a083aa59550a23c27276f827d8e0ad6
1 Input
2 Outputs
- 81fbb4e8af1b25dea1cc5d3dc3961df04a083aa59550a23c27276f827d8e0ad6:0
- 81fbb4e8af1b25dea1cc5d3dc3961df04a083aa59550a23c27276f827d8e0ad6:1
value 8745517
address 3JTpUAYe6Cm4zaiUFJ1UznTyaL1F6xMr6n
value 17340695
address 1EBiboum5t2Pm2b2qHY3s33WZNTjZ7Yb8H